I'm not very familiar with capabilities. But I think that the closest
thing to a capability that you get in the Hurd is a send right to a
particular Mach port. Whether or not is really like a capability
system depends on how much functionality is behind each port. I
suspects uid:s will not be fine-grained enough to qualify as a
capability system. But that will depend on how they are used, I guess.

To me, this sounds a little like making the nethack program setuid or
setgid. The tricky part is *how* the program gets the write
permissions for the file (which could be an extra uid, send right, or
capability). In the setuid/setgid case, the program is given that
permission when it is installed, and the administrator has to trust
the program not to misuse that.

With more fine-grained capabilities you can grant more precise power
to the program (e.g. access to a particular file only), but I don't
see how you can avoid making the decision to permanently delegate
extra power to the program in some way or another.
